Python XML Parser Tutorial | Read and Write XML in Python | Python Training | Edureka

///Python XML Parser Tutorial | Read and Write XML in Python | Python Training | Edureka

Python XML Parser Tutorial | Read and Write XML in Python | Python Training | Edureka

FavoriteLoadingAdd to favorites

** Python Certification Training: **
This Edureka video on ‘Python XML Parser Tutorial’ is to educate you about parsing and modifying XML in Python. Below are the topics covered in this video:

Introduction to xml and parsing
Python xml parsing modules
xml.etree.ElementTree module
xml.dom.minidom module

Python Tutorial Playlist:
Blog Series:

#Edureka #PythonEdureka #PythonXMLParserTutorial #pythonProgramming #pythonTutorial #PythonTraining

Do subscribe to our channel and hit the bell icon to never miss an update from us in the future:


How it Works?

1. This is a 5 Week Instructor-led Online Course,40 hours of assignment and 20 hours of project work
2. We have a 24×7 One-on-One LIVE Technical Support to help you with any problems you might face or any clarifications you may require during the course.
3. At the end of the training, you will be working on a real-time project for which we will provide you a Grade and a Verifiable Certificate!

– – – – – – – – – – – – – – – – –
About the Course

Edureka’s Python Online Certification Training will make you an expert in Python programming. It will also help you learn Python the Big data way with integration of Machine learning, Pig, Hive and Web Scraping through beautiful soup. During our Python Certification training, our instructors will help you:

1. Master the Basic and Advanced Concepts of Python
2. Understand Python Scripts on UNIX/Windows, Python Editors and IDEs
3. Master the Concepts of Sequences and File operations
4. Learn how to use and create functions, sorting different elements, Lambda function, error handling techniques and Regular expressions ans using modules in Python
5. Gain expertise in machine learning using Python and build a Real Life Machine Learning application
6. Understand the supervised and unsupervised learning and concepts of Scikit-Learn
7. Master the concepts of MapReduce in Hadoop
8. Learn to write Complex MapReduce programs
9. Understand what is PIG and HIVE, Streaming feature in Hadoop, MapReduce job running with Python
10. Implementing a PIG UDF in Python, Writing a HIVE UDF in Python, Pydoop and/Or MRjob Basics
11. Master the concepts of Web scraping in Python
12. Work on a Real Life Project on Big Data Analytics using Python and gain Hands on Project Experience

– – – – – – – – – – – – – – – – – – –
Why learn Python?

Programmers love Python because of how fast and easy it is to use. Python cuts development time in half with its simple to read syntax and easy compilation feature. Debugging your programs is a breeze in Python with its built in debugger. Using Python makes Programmers more productive and their programs ultimately better. Python continues to be a favorite option for data scientists who use it for building and using Machine learning applications and other scientific computations.
Python runs on Windows, Linux/Unix, Mac OS and has been ported to Java and .NET virtual machines. Python is free to use, even for the commercial products, because of its OSI-approved open source license.
Python has evolved as the most preferred Language for Data Analytics and the increasing search trends on python also indicates that Python is the next “Big Thing” and a must for Professionals in the Data Analytics domain.

Who should go for python?

Edureka’s Data Science certification course in Python is a good fit for the below professionals:

· Programmers, Developers, Technical Leads, Architects
· Developers aspiring to be a ‘Machine Learning Engineer’
· Analytics Managers who are leading a team of analysts
· Business Analysts who want to understand Machine Learning (ML) Techniques
· Information Architects who want to gain expertise in Predictive Analytics
· ‘Python’ professionals who want to design automatic predictive models

For more information, Please write back to us at or call us at IND: 9606058406 / US: 18338555775 (toll free)


By |2020-08-18T08:58:43+00:00August 18th, 2020|Python Video Tutorials|15 Comments


  1. edureka! August 18, 2020 at 8:58 am - Reply

    Got a question on the topic? Share it in the comment section below. Please drop a comment if you need the codes discussed in this video. For Edureka Python Data Science Course curriculum, Visit our Website: Use code "YOUTUBE20" to get Flat 20% off on this training.

  2. USURUPATI AVINASH 7B91A04M2 August 18, 2020 at 8:58 am - Reply

    In sample.xml file the first line (<?xml version="1.0" enoding="UTF-8"?>)is showing error as 'The encoding declaration is required in the text declaration'.how to modify the first line so that the code becomes execute for the

  3. Kulbir Ahluwalia August 18, 2020 at 8:58 am - Reply

    Amazing explanation! Thank you so much!

  4. rijo varghese August 18, 2020 at 8:58 am - Reply

    How do I increment the tag name if it has the same name Ex: <food><item>Idly</item><item>Dosa</item></food> to be written as <food><item1>Idly</item1><item2>Dosa</item2></food>

  5. Kingdom of thoughts August 18, 2020 at 8:58 am - Reply

    you have a lovely accent @->– , thanks for the tutorial

  6. keshav dk August 18, 2020 at 8:58 am - Reply

    Thank you for this video.

    Can you add the Sample.xml file which is explained in the video for testing.

  7. Him Bhavsar August 18, 2020 at 8:58 am - Reply

    It was good, But how can we add main child with it's all child attributes like there is a food tag and i want to make one more food tag with same containing tags

  8. Christo George August 18, 2020 at 8:58 am - Reply

    Very Helpful Tutorial,

  9. sachguru1 August 18, 2020 at 8:58 am - Reply

    Thank you for covering almost all the scenarios.. very helpfull

  10. Rashmi Solanki August 18, 2020 at 8:58 am - Reply

    I am finding difficulty in installing xml.etree.ElementTree for python 3.7 any help

  11. GFW777 August 18, 2020 at 8:58 am - Reply

    Excellent – Thanks

  12. sachin verma August 18, 2020 at 8:58 am - Reply

    Thanks a lot 😊

  13. MADHAVENDRA SHARMA August 18, 2020 at 8:58 am - Reply

    Can you elaborate about writing xml data with DOM

  14. Amazing URDU/HINDI Poetry August 18, 2020 at 8:58 am - Reply


  15. yugesh kumar August 18, 2020 at 8:58 am - Reply


Leave A Comment